Transaction 70b5c84763ddb43fe12c51f1dc3c87ced79e3053bf22fc00c122ce3c2914fafb
1 Input
1 Output
-
70b5c84763ddb43fe12c51f1dc3c87ced79e3053bf22fc00c122ce3c2914fafb:0
- value
- 799086
- script pubkey
- OP_0 OP_PUSHBYTES_20 50087fcb778fa34864eaa8256662ba6c1ed59499
- address
- bc1q2qy8ljmh3735se824qjkvc46ds0dt9yerdzysn